3. Preparation for operation
3.1. Checking oil level (A and B diagrams)
Warning
Always check the engine oil level before starting.
Checking and topping up should be carried out with the generating set on a horizontal surface.
Open the enclosure (No. 7, fig. A) with a screwdriver
Unscrew and take off the oil filler cap (fig. B) and wipe the dipstick, then, introduce the dipstick into the filler
neck without screwing it on
Remove the dipstick and examine the oil level
If it requires topping up, top up with new approved oil to the top of filler tube. Wipe off excess oil with a
clean cloth.
Refit the oil filler cap and screw in place.
3.2. Checking the fuel level (diagram C)
Danger
Stop the motor before filling up with fuel and fill up in a well-ventilated area.
Do not smoke, or bring naked flames or sparks near to the area where you are filling up with
fuel or where the fuel is stored.
Only use clean fuel without any water.
Do not overfill the tank (there should not be any fuel in the filler neck).
When you have filled up, ensure that the tank cap is closed correctly.
Take care not to spill any fuel when filling the tank.
Before starting up the generating set, and if any fuel has been spilt, make sure that it has dried
and that the vapours have cleared away.
Check the fuel level and fill it up to the maximum level, if necessary (fig. C).
3.3. Checking the air filter
Check that the air filter is clean and in correct working order (paragraph 7.1)
3.4. Earthing the generating set
To earth the generating set, use a 10 mm2 copper wire attached to the generating set earth connection and to an
earthing rod of galvanised steel set in the ground to a depth of 1 metre. This also dissipates the static electricity
that builds up in the electrical machines.
3.5. Siting the set for use
Place the generating set on a flat, horizontal surface which is firm enough to prevent the set sinking down (under
no circumstances should the set tilt any direction by more than 10°).
Choose a site that is clean, well-ventilated and sheltered from bad weather, and store the additional supplies of
oil and fuel within close proximity, although respecting a certain distance for safety.
